X, Y and Z are equal partners of XYZ Partnership. A owes the XYZ Partnership for P9,000. Z, a partner, collected from A P3,000 before X and Y received anything. Z issued a receipt on the P3,000 as his share of what A owes. When X and Y collected from A, A was insolvent.

a. X and Y should first exhaust all remedies to collect from A.

b. Partner Z shall share partners X and Y with P3,000

c. X and Y can automatically deduct from the capital contributions of Z in the partnership their respective share in the P3,000

d. Z cannot be required to share X and Y with the P3,000
